Tocqueville Asset Management L.P. Grows Stock Holdings in Hewlett Packard Enterprise (NYSE:HPE)

Tocqueville Asset Management L.P. boosted its holdings in Hewlett Packard Enterprise (NYSE:HPEFree Report) by 51.5% during the 4th quarter, according to its most recent disclosure with the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C). The fund owned 17,116 shares of the technology company’s stock after buying an additional 5,822 shares during the quarter. Tocqueville Asset Management L.P.’s holdings in Hewlett Packard Enterprise were worth $365,000 at the end of the most recent quarter.

About Hewlett Packard Enterprise

Hewlett Packard Enterprise Company provides solutions that allow customers to capture, analyze, and act upon data seamlessly in the Americas, Europe, the Middle East, Africa, the Asia Pacific, and Japan. It operates in six segments: Compute, HPC & AI, Storage, Intelligent Edge, Financial Services, and Corporate Investments and Other.
